Financial Aid Designed Just for you
A financial aid package is the total amount of financial aid offered by Culver-Stockton College. Our financial aid staff combines various forms of aid into a package to help meet your costs. We understand that everyone’s financial situation is unique and there is no one size fits all solution.
2022-2023
Fee Description | Fee |
---|---|
Full-Time Tuition12 or more hours each semester | $28,700 |
Room* on campus | $4,150 |
Board full board plan, (others available) | $5,120 |
Unified Student Fee | $495 |
TOTAL ** | $38,465 |
2023-2024
Fee Description | Fee |
---|---|
Full-Time Tuition12 or more hours each semester | $29,420 |
Room* on campus | $4,255 |
Board full board plan, (others available) | $5,250 |
Unified Student Fee | $495 |
TOTAL ** | $39,420 |
* Stone Hall is an additional $1,000 per year; Brown Hall is an additional $500 per year.
** Please refer to the Academic Catalog for additional fees and withdrawal/refund policies.
